Do you think pinup and fetish are becoming part of the mainstream culture?

I think fetish has always been a part of fashion, items such as high-heels and lingerie are fetish objects without there needing to be a whip in there too. Anything that inspires devotion and obsession is in a sense fetishised. I don't know that the bdsm/fetish scene will ever become entirely mainstream, it is after all an alternative sexuality. But fetish fashion is always flitting in and out of view, corsets, heels, latex and leather are often seen on celebrities. Pin-up and burlesque are becoming more and more well-known with clubs starting all round the country and stars like Dita Von Teese bringing it to people's attention. If anything I think pin-up and fetish have become a bit more acceptable, they've lost some of their seediness. In alternative crowds an interest in fetish and bdsm isn't seen as all that strange or unusual, so I think a lot more people are becoming open about their various kinks, embracing their inner perverts.
